Job Opportunity - Project Coordinator, SFU Community-Engaged Research Initiative (CERi), Vancouver, BC
September 05, 2025
The SFU Community-Engaged Research Initiative (CERi) is currently hiring a Project Coordinator to support the 312 Main Research Shop and contribute to a wide range of community-engaged research projects. This is an exciting paid opportunity for current SFU graduate students to gain meaningful experience in project coordination, evaluation research, community partnership development, and social impact work.
Position Highlights:
- Title: Project Coordinator – SFU CERi
- Eligibility: Open to currently enrolled SFU graduate students
- Type: Part-time (15 hrs/week), 1-year term with possible extension
- Start Date: Early October 2025
- Location: Hybrid (remote + in-person at 312 Main, Vancouver)
- Compensation: $32–$36/hour + benefits
- Deadline to Apply: September 21, 2025 (end of day)
This role is ideal for students interested in community-engaged research, social equity, evaluation, and applied research practices.
